Burning incense ignites storage room fire in Sedona

Thursday morning, Sedona Fire responded to a fire at a storage unit on Shelby Drive. Crews arrived to find the fire had been extinguished by the buildings fire sprinkler system. Fire Marshal Jon Davis says crews removed the items from the unit and checked neighboring units. Some items suffered minor water damage. Damage is estimated at under $5,000. The fire was started when a renter lit an incense stick while cleaning out the unit. The renter had left the area, but failed to put out the incense stick; when they returned, fire crews were on scene.
